2.

A tourist views a deer from a height of 45 feet.  The horizontal distance between the tourist and the deer is 130 feet.  How many degrees should the tourist tilt his camera down to photograph the deer? Round your answer to the nearest degree.  

a)

19 degrees

b)

45 degrees

c)

71 degrees

d)

138 degrees 

3.

A hawk sitting on a tree branch spots a mouse on the ground 15 feet from the base of the tree.  The hawk swoops down toward the mouse at an angle of 30 degrees. What is the distance from the tree branch to the mouse? 

a)

7.5 ft 

b)

15 ft 

c)

26 ft 

d)

30 ft 

4.

A 13 ft. ladder is leaning against the house. The top of the ladder touches the house at 10 feet above the ground. How far away is the bottom of the ladder from the house?

a)

10 feet

b)

7.5 feet

c)

8.3 feet

d)

3.8 feet

17.

You are standing 10 feet away from a tree. There is a cat up in the tree. Your eyes make a 48 degree angle to look up at the cat. How high is the cat?

a)

11.1 ft.

b)

9 ft.

c)

7.4 ft.

d)

13.8 ft.

18.

A 30 ft. wire stretches from the top of a light pole diagonally to the ground. The light pole is 10 feet high. What is the angle the wire makes with the ground?

a)

66 degrees

b)

80 degrees

c)

30 degrees

d)

19 degrees

19.

Jake is 6 ft. tall. He is standing outside when the angle of elevation of the sun is 28 degrees. How long would his shadow be? 

a)

5.3 feet

b)

2.8 feet

c)

3.2 feet

d)

11.3 feet

20.

A plane takes off at an angle of 30 degrees and reaches a height of 10 miles.  What is the diagonal distance it has traveled from take off to it's current position?

a)

15 miles

b)

38 miles

c)

17 miles

d)

20 miles
